English Indices of Deprivation 2025 for Islington 011G, the published LSOA linked to this postcode. Decile 1 contains the most deprived 10% of English LSOAs and decile 10 the least deprived 10%.
Overall IMD decile
4 of 10
Overall England rank
11,132 of 33,755
These are relative area statistics, not measures of an individual household, affluence or absolute change. They cannot be compared with indices for other UK nations. Source: English Indices of Deprivation 2025, version 2025-v2.
